Moving from Allegheny County, PA to Duval County, FL is estimated to cost $5,545 more per year. To maintain similar purchasing power, a $50,000 salary in Allegheny County, PA would need to be about $55,915 in Duval County, FL. The biggest increase is housing, followed by healthcare.

This is a 11.83% increase in modeled annual costs. Housing is $3,116 per year higher (24.07%); Healthcare is $1,471 per year higher (36.88%).

Below we break down the annual categories behind the difference using Economic Policy Institute 2026 Family Budget data.
